Recession onset spurs harsh parenting

The onset of the Great Recession and, more generally, deteriorating economic conditions lead mothers to engage in harsh parenting, such as hitting or shouting at children, a team of researchers has found. But the effect is only found in mothers who carry a gene variation that makes them more likely to react to their environment.

The study, conducted by scholars at New York University, Columbia University, Princeton University, and Pennsylvania State University's College of Medicine, appears in the journal Proceedings of the National Academy of Sciences (PNAS).

"It's commonly thought that economic hardship within families leads to stress, which, in turn, leads to deterioration of parenting quality," said Dohoon Lee, an assistant professor of sociology at NYU and lead author of the paper.

"But these findings show that an economic downturn in the larger community can adversely affect parenting—regardless of the conditions individual families face."

Dohoon Lee
The researchers found that harsh parenting increased as economic conditions worsened only for those with what has been called the "sensitive" allele, or variation, of the DRD2 Taq1A genotype, which controls the synthesis of dopamine, a behaviour-regulating chemical in the brain.

Deteriorating economic conditions had no effect on the level of harsh parenting of mothers without the 'sensitive allele'. Just more than half of the mothers in the study had the sensitive, or T, allele.

Likewise, the researchers found that mothers with the 'sensitive allele' had lower levels of harsh parenting when economic conditions were improving compared with those without the sensitive allele.

Irwin Garfinkel
"This finding provides further evidence in favor of the orchid-dandelion hypothesis that humans with sensitive genes, like orchids, wilt or die in poor environments, but flourish in rich environments, whereas dandelions survive in poor and rich environments," said Irwin Garfinkel, a co-author of the paper and the Mitchell I. Ginsberg Professor of Contemporary Urban Problems at the Columbia University School of Social Work (CUSSW).

The findings were based on data from the Fragile Families and Child Wellbeing Study (FFS), a population-based, birth cohort study conducted by researchers at Princeton and Columbia of nearly 5,000 children born in 20 large American cities between 1998 and 2000.

Mothers were interviewed shortly after giving birth and when the child was approximately 1, 3, 5, and 9 years old. Data on harsh parenting were collected when the child was 3, 5, and 9 years old. In Year 9, saliva DNA samples were collected from 2,600 mothers and children.

Harsh parenting was measured using 10 items from the commonly used Conflict Tactics Scale—five items measured psychological harsh parenting (e.g., shouting, threatening, etc.) and five gauged corporal punishment (e.g., spanking, slapping).

The researchers supplemented these data with measurements of economic conditions in each of the 20 cities where the FFS mothers lived.

Specifically, they examined city-level data on monthly unemployment rates, obtained from the Bureau of Labor Statistics' Local Area Unemployment Statistics, and the Consumer Sentiment Index, obtained from the Thomson Reuters/University of Michigan Surveys of Consumers.

In their analysis, they controlled for age, race/ethnicity, immigration status, educational attainment, poverty status, family structure, and child gender and child age (in months) at the time of interview.

The results showed that, contrary to common perceptions, harsh parenting was not positively associated with high levels of unemployment among those studied.

Rather, these behaviours were linked to increases in a city's unemployment rate and declines in national consumer sentiment, or confidence, in the economy.

The researchers concluded that it is the anticipation of adversity i.e the fear of losing one's job due to deteriorating economic conditions, that is a more important determinant of harsh parenting than poor economic conditions or even actual economic hardship a family faces.

Sara McLanahan
"People can adjust to difficult circumstances once they know what to expect, whereas fear or uncertainty about the future is more difficult to deal with," said Sara McLanahan, Princeton's William S. Tod Professor of Sociology and Public Affairs and a co-author of the paper.

In the past, researchers have focused on "bad" or "risky" genes and difficult environments without giving enough attention to how people with these genes may perform in high-quality environments, McLanahan said.

Sibling Rivalry: Children are stressed when fathers play favourites

Research by Megan Gilligan, a Purdue doctoral student in sociology, and Jill Suitor, a professor of sociology, found that sibling Baby Boomers are likely to be more stressed by their fathers' favouring one over another than by their mothers' doing so. 

Credit: Purdue University photo /Mark Simons

"It didn't matter who fathers favored. When favouritism was perceived there was tension among siblings, especially daughters," said Megan Gilligan, a Purdue doctoral student in sociology who is lead author on the article.

"Often the role of fathers is overlooked in these older relationships, but what we found shows dads do matter."

This research, which is published in the July issue of the Journal of Gerontology, Series B: Psychological Sciences and Social Sciences, looked at 137 later-life families with both parents still alive when the data was collected in 2008.

The average age of the 341 siblings was 49, and they were asked about tension among each other and the perceived favouritism by their parents.

The parents were in their 70s and 80s, and the fathers were an average of three years older than the mothers.

"The importance of fathers' favouritism may come from these older adults noticing many of their friends' fathers no longer living, so they may value their dads even more than before; they realise their time together is limited," said Jill Suitor, a professor of sociology and article co-author.

Previous research by Suitor, Gilligan and Karl Pillemer, professor of human development in the College of Human Ecology at Cornell University, showed that if mothers favoured a child, it caused sibling tension.

However, that work focused only on mothers' favouritism. By looking at both living parents in this recent article, the researchers were able to evaluate the consequences of favouritism from both parents.

This research is based on the survey data from the Within-Family Difference Study, led by Suitor and Pillemer to evaluate the role favoritism plays in adult family relationships.

The data for the 13-year project were collected in the Boston metropolitan area. The project is funded by the US National Institute on Aging.

"The implications of these findings will be important to practitioners," Pillemer said. "We often think of the family as a single unit, and this reminds us that individual parent and child relationships differ and each family is very complex. Favouritism from the father could mean something different than favouritism from the mother. We suggest that clinicians who work with families on later-life issues be aware of this complexity and look for such types of individual relationships as they advise families on care giving, legal and financial issues."

The difference in this research could be the result of the role fathers played in this older generation.

"Fathers are important figures in families, and the father-child relationship is sometimes more tenuous than the mother-child tie," Suitor said.

"Mothers are often more open and affectionate with their children, whereas fathers have sometimes been found to be more critical, leading offspring to be more concerned when fathers favour some children over others."

This also could play a role in why daughters experience more tension with their siblings when fathers favour them.

"The gender difference may occur because fathers, as other studies have shown, often invest more in their sons, thus, the favouritism shown toward daughters may violate these norms and result in greater sibling tension," Gilligan said.

"For these reasons, when adult children perceive their fathers as engaging in favouritism, there may be greater concern about competition for his affection and support, resulting in higher levels of sibling tension."

Gilligan and Suitor also said that these values and norms may have changed since the Baby Boomer generation.

Suitor, Pillemer and Gilligan plan to extend the present project to include interviewing the Baby Boomers about their own adult children.

Mindfulness: Increasing Wellbeing and Reducing Stress in UK school children


Mindfulness – a mental training that develops sustained attention that can change the ways people think, act and feel – could reduce symptoms of stress and depression and promote wellbeing among school children, according to a new study published online by the British Journal of Psychiatry.

With the summer exam season in full swing, school children are currently experiencing higher levels of stress than at any other time of year.

The research showed that interventions to reduce stress in children have the biggest impact at this time of year.

There is growing evidence that mindfulness-based approaches for adults are effective at enhancing mental health and wellbeing.

However, very few controlled trials have evaluated their effectiveness among young people.

A team of researchers led by Professor Willem Kuyken from the University of Exeter, in association with the University of Oxford, the University of Cambridge and the Mindfulness in Schools Project, recruited 522 pupils, aged between 12 and 16 years, from 12 secondary schools to take part in the study.

256 pupils at six of the schools were taught the Mindfulness in Schools Project's curriculum, a nine week introduction to mindfulness designed for the classroom.

Richard Burnett who co-created the curriculum said: "Our mindfulness curriculum aims to engage even the most cynical of adolescent audience with the basics of mindfulness. We use striking visuals, film clips and activities to bring it to life without losing the expertise and integrity of classic mindfulness teaching".

The other 266 pupils at the other six schools did not receive the mindfulness lessons, and acted as a control group.

All the pupils were followed up after a three month period. The follow-up was timed to coincide with the summer exam period – which is a potential time of high stress for young people.

The researchers found that those children who participated in the mindfulness programme reported fewer depressive symptoms, lower stress and greater wellbeing than the young people in the control group.

Encouragingly, around 80% of the young people said they continued using practices taught in MiSP's mindfulness curriculum after completing the nine week programme.

Teachers and schools also rated the curriculum as worthwhile and very enjoyable to learn and teach.

Higher activity levels may protect children from stress

Children with lower levels of daytime physical activity (PA) have higher hypothalamic-pituitary-adrenocortical axis activity (HPAA) in response to psychosocial stress, suggesting that PA may help children cope with stressful situations, according to research published online March 7 in the Journal of Clinical Endocrinology & Metabolism.

Silja Martikainen, of the University of Helsinki, and colleagues conducted a cross-sectional study of 258 8-year-old children to evaluate whether PA levels affected HPAA activity and HPAA response to psychosocial stress. PA was measured using a wrist accelerometer.

Stressors included doing arithmetic and being assigned to tell a story to an audience.

The researchers found that, after exposure to everyday stressors, children with the highest levels of PA or vigorous PA showed very little, if any, increase in salivary cortisol levels when compared to more sedentary children in the lowest and intermediate PA groups.

"Our study shows that increased levels of PA are associated with decreased HPAA reactivity to stress in a community sample of 8-year-old children," the authors write.

"Although children with different levels of PA show similar diurnal patterns of salivary cortisol, the children with the lowest activity levels are more responsive to psychosocial stress. Consequently, PA may contribute to the psychological well-being of children by regulating their neuro-endocrine reactivity to stress."

ADD vs APD: When an Attention Issue is Really an Auditory Issue

When your child is struggling in school, you want to get to the root of the issue as quickly as possible. Nowadays there is more awareness about a wide spectrum of learning problems.

Most teachers receive some training about the major diagnoses, and educational psychologists have a full toolkit of diagnostic assessments.

Once you have a name for the symptoms you are seeing, plans can be made to ensure that the education provided is appropriate for a child’s needs.

But what happens if you suspect that the diagnosis your child receives is the wrong

ADD (Attention Deficit Disorder) is a familiar term to most parents. ADD diagnoses have been on the rise for the last few decades. However, there is a lesser known disorder, with a similar list of symptoms, which may be overlooked: APD (Auditory Processing Disorder).

APD may initially present as an attention deficit issue, but in reality it has nothing to do with a child’s ability to sit still. Rather, APD stems from a weakness in the ability of the brain to process the sounds it receives.

This specific weakness can be either acquired through brain injury or illness, or genetically inherited.

Symptoms
  • ADD and APD share a number of symptoms, such as:
  • Struggling to focus in a noisy environment
  • Fidgety and easily distracted
  • Showing some aggression or even isolation socially
  • Difficulty following directions
  • Lower academic performance
  • Zoning out in a conversation

Each of these external symptoms has a different internal cause, depending on the diagnosis. Both can in turn cause reading problems, and both appear in the 7 Main Causes of Reading Difficulty (video).



Children with ADD struggle with the above symptoms because there is insufficient activity in the frontal lobe to regulate the strong neuronal activity in the cerebral cortex.

Without the necessary control over the cerebral cortex, the activity there is just unregulated ‘brain noise’ of neuronal chaos.

Children with APD, on the other hand, struggle with these symptoms because the world around them sounds ‘foggy’ or unclear.

A child with APD will have perfect hearing; the problem lies in the brain’s interpretation of incoming sounds, not the hearing mechanism itself.

The Power of a Mother's touch

Mothers who stroke their baby's body in the first few weeks after birth may change the effects that stress during pregnancy can have on an infant's early-life development, researchers have found.

Researchers at the Universities of Liverpool, Manchester, and Kings College, London have been studying whether stress in pregnancy can lead to emotional and behavioural problems in children for many years.

Attention is now moving towards how parents might alter these effects after birth.

Researchers are aiming to improve understanding of the issues to help enhance information services for pregnant women and their partners.

Scientists believe that stress in pregnancy can have an effect on an infant in later life by reducing the activity of genes that play a role in stress response.

Studies of early care-giving in rats have found that high levels of mothers' licking and grooming their pups soon after birth can increase the activity of these genes and may reverse the effects of prenatal stress on their offspring.

Some studies suggest that impacts of prenatal stress on an infant's development can be either positive or negative depending on the type of environment a child encounters. It is thought that some children may experience the effects through being more prone to high levels of fear or anger.

The team at Liverpool, Manchester and London followed first-time mothers from pregnancy through to the first years of their children's lives as part of Medical Research Council (MRC) funded research, The Wirral Child Health and Development Study.

It showed that links between symptoms of depression in pregnancy and subsequent infant emotions of fear and anger, as well as heart rate response to stress at seven months of age changed by how often a mother stroked their baby on the head, back, legs and arms in the early weeks of life.

The results suggest that stroking may alter gene activity in a similar way to that reported in animals.

Dr Helen Sharp, from the University of Liverpool's Institute of Psychology, Health and Society, explains: "We are currently following up on the Wirral children in our study to see if reports of early stroking by their mothers continue to make a difference to developmental outcomes over time.

"The eventual aim is to find out whether we should recommend that mothers who have been stressed during pregnancy should be encouraged to stroke their babies early in life"

The study is published in the journal PLOS ONE.

Stress may delay brain development in early years

Stress may affect brain development in children, altering growth of a specific piece of the brain and abilities associated with it, according to researchers at the University of Wisconsin-Madison.

"There has been a lot of work in animals linking both acute and chronic stress to changes in a part of the brain called the prefrontal cortex, which is involved in complex cognitive abilities like holding on to important information for quick recall and use," says Jamie Hanson, a UW-Madison psychology graduate student.

"We have now found similar associations in humans, and found that more exposure to stress is related to more issues with certain kinds of cognitive processes."

Children who had experienced more intense and lasting stressful events in their lives posted lower scores on tests of what the researchers refer to as spatial working memory. They had more trouble navigating tests of short-term memory such as finding a token in a series of boxes, according to the study, which will be published in the June 6 issue of the Journal of Neuroscience.

Brain scans revealed that the anterior cingulate, a portion of the prefrontal cortex believed to play key roles in spatial working memory, takes up less space in children with greater exposure to very stressful situations.

"These are subtle differences, but differences related to important cognitive abilities" Hanson says.

But they maybe not irreversible differences.

"We're not trying to argue that stress permanently scars your brain. We don't know if and how it is that stress affects the brain," Hanson says. "We only have a snapshot -- one MRI scan of each subject -- and at this point we don't understand whether this is just a delay in development or a lasting difference. It could be that, because the brains is very plastic, very able to change, that children who have experienced a great deal of stress catch up in these areas."

The researchers determined stress levels through interviews with children ages 9 to 14 and their parents. The research team, which included UW-Madison psychology professors Richard Davidson and Seth Pollak and their labs, collected expansive biographies of stressful events from slight to severe.

"Instead of focusing in on one specific type of stress, we tried to look at a range of stressors," Hanson says. "We wanted to know as much as we could, and then use all this information to later to get an idea of how challenging and chronic and intense each experience was for the child."

Interestingly, there was little correlation between cumulative life stress and age. That is, children who had several more years of life in which to experience stressful episodes were no more likely than their younger peers to have accumulated a length stress resume. Puberty, on the other hand, typically went hand-in-hand with heavier doses of stress.

The researchers, whose work was funded by the National Institutes of Health, also took note of changes in brain tissue known as white matter and gray matter. In the important brain areas that varied in volume with stress, the white and gray matter volumes were lower in tandem.

White matter, Hanson explained, is like the long-distance wiring of the brain. It connects separated parts of the brain so that they can share information. Gray matter "does the math," Hanson says. "It takes care of the processing, using the information that gets shared along the white matter connections."

Blood Test Diagnoses Depression In Teens

Diagnosing depression may soon include a simple blood test, according to research published Tuesday. new study. Researchers developed a blood test to identify markers for depression in teenagers that maylead to better treatments and lessen the stigma surrounding the condition.

Doctors currently rely on patients coming forward with symptoms to diagnose depression. However, differentiating between types of depression can be difficult without an objective diagnosis, researchers said. Instead, using a diagnostic blood test could allow for more personalized treatment.

"Right now depression is treated with a blunt instrument," Dr. Eva Redei, study author and professor of psychiatry at Northwestern University, said in a statement. "It's like treating type 1 diabetes and type 2 diabetes exactly the same way. We need to do better."

Previous studies identified 26 potential genetic markers for depression in rats. Redei and her team found 11 similar markers in depressed teens that they did not find in the control group.

"These 11 genes are probably the tip of the iceberg because depression is a complex illness," Redei said in a statement. "But it's an entree into a much bigger phenomenon that has to be explored. It clearly indicates we can diagnose from blood and create a blood diagnosis test for depression."

Some doctors remain skeptical of the findings since the study examined only 28 volunteers. Skeptics said research needs to show whether the markers can test a wider population and whether the markers are present in adults as well before the test can be considered viable.

"I think people are looking for a magic bullet, a single answer," Dr. Carol Bernstein, an associate professor of psychiatry at New York University, told ABC News. "But these disorders are much too complicated."

One in 20 Americans over the age of 12 reported feeling symptoms of depression between 2005 and 2006, according to the Centers for Disease Control and Prevention. Symptoms include hopelessness, feeling like a failure, poor appetite and lack of interest in activities.

Depression affects approximately 1 percent of children under the age of 12, researchers said. But as children enter their teenage years, depression affects almost 25 percent. Depression that sets in during the teenage years has a poorer prognosis than depression that sets in in adulthood, increasing the risk of substance abuse, suicide and physical illness, researchers said.

Being able to diagnose depression with a blood test could mean more people getting treatment. None of the teens who were diagnosed with depression over the course of the study opted for treatment, most likely due to the stigma that comes with it, Redei said.

Depression is treated through a combination of medication and therapy, but many people see the disease as a defect and think it will make people view them as "broken", Dr. Jonathan Rottenberg, an associate professor of psychology at the University of South Florida, said in a Psychology Today blog post.

 The journal Translational Psychiatry published the study on Tuesday.

Dr. Kellye Knueppel noted that what a client's daughter was experiencing was not uncommon. Letter and /or word reversal.

“From approximately age 5 to age 11, directionality concepts are developing, so reversals are normal at younger ages,” she said. 

Dr. Knueppel also shared that educators are usually taught that reversals are normal until age 8, and typically, no action is taken even if the child at ages 6 or 7 reverses things more frequently than his or her peers.

“We have tests to determine if the amount of reversals the child is doing is actually age appropriate or not,” Dr. Knueppel said. 

“If it is, we would just monitor the situation. If the reversals are more frequent than they should be, we would work on laterality and directionality concepts.”

If you notice frequent reversals, as she did with her client's daughter, consider a Functional Vision Test

You may find out that, as Dr. Knueppel noted, your child’s word reversals are normal.  However, if you find there is a problem, you can pursue the treatment that will allow for healthy visual development.

Does BPA make girls anxious, hyperactive, etc

Girls exposed before birth to high levels of the estrogen-like chemical BPA are more likely to be anxious, depressed and hyperactive at age 3, according to a study in today's Pediatrics.

Boys' behaviour was unaffected by BPA, the study says.
Scientists in recent years have linked BPA, or bisphenol A, to a wide variety of health problems, from breast cancer to diabetes. 

BPA is found in countless consumer products, from plastic bottles to dental sealants, medical equipment, receipt paper and the linings of metal food and drink cans.

Virtually everyone is exposed to BPA. Authors of the new study found BPA in the urine of more than 97% of the 240 pregnant women studied, as well as 97% of their children. 

Being exposed to high BPA levels after birth didn't appear to affect behavior, says study author, Joe Braun, a research fellow at the Harvard School of Public Health.

That could be because BPA, like lead and other toxins, causes the greatest harm before birth, when the fetal brain is developing, says pediatrician Philip Landrigan, a professor at New York's Mount Sinai School of Medicine, who was not involved in the new study. "Parents should be concerned about these findings," Landrigan says.

About 12% of boys and 6% of girls have been diagnosed with ADHD, or attention deficit hyperactivity disorder, according to the U.S. Census Bureau.

Girls are about twice as likely as boys to be depressed or anxious, Braun says. Few kids in the study were depressed or anxious enough to meet the requirements for a clinical diagnosis, says Braun, noting that only 2% to 3% of children this age are diagnosed with these problems. 

But Braun says the differences in behaviour between children in his study are comparable to the effects seen with high exposure to toxins such as lead, mercury and pesticides.

Steven Hentges, a spokesman for the American Chemistry Council, says the study's "conclusions are of unknown relevance to public health." He notes that regulators in Europe, Japan and the USA "have … reviewed hundreds of studies on BPA and repeatedly supported the continued safe use of BPA."

Yet Landrigan says studies like this are precisely why the FDA needs to act to protect people from BPA. In the meantime, he says pregnant women should try to reduce their exposure.

How to Encourage Resilience in Children

It seems that certain people are just made to handle adversity. No matter what comes their way they find a solution and don’t seem overly concerned.

Though, resilience doesn’t come out of nowhere. These people learned somewhere along the way how to deal with problems and find value within life’s difficulties.

Why is resilience important?
Resilience offers protective factors against mental and physical illness, providing a buffer against stress, strain, and anxiety. When it comes to children, helping them understand risk factors in their life and how to face these competently is cruical to raising a confident and self-discplined children.


Resilience in children
A resilient child is able to adapt when faced with adversity and feels competent when solving new problems. They view obstacles as challenges to rise to, instead of stressors to avoid. From a parenting perspective we must show children unconditional love and support, and be a figure to help them grow and learn.

Here are a few building blocks for developing resilience and self-reliance in children.

Problem solving - Having a Growth Mindset
Resilience can be seen through Carol Dweck’s research on school children and their perception of intelligence and ability. Children answered a series of questions and were praised with different comments steering the child’s focus to either intelligence or effort.

For instance:
“You must be really smart!”
“You must have worked really hard at this!”

The students were then offered a choice of doing a harder or easier assignment. Students who’s feedback was highlighted with hard work were willing to try the more difficult task.

The children who focused on effort were explained to have a growth mindset, where as children which had a focus on the stable nature of intelligence and ability tended to have a fixed mindset.

Someone with a growth mindset knows that learning takes hard work and practice, and is willing to put in the necessary effort to find a solution.

Someone with a fixed mindset on the other hand will assume that how they performed predicts a fixed ability. If they didn’t know the answer to a math problem, this means they aren’t good at math. If they aren’t good at math what’s the use in trying?

We need to help children have a growth mindset by emphasizing hard work, a willingness to try, and the importance of practice.

Responsibility and achievement
Help children to understand that behaviors have consequences and to learn to do things on their own. Don’t solve all their problems or give them the immediate solution. By letting children take an appropriate amount of responsibility they can begin to develop self-confidence and build self-efficacy through gradual success.

Helping children gain mastery from experiences plants the seed for ambition, motivation, and learning.

A few suggestions to help children gain mastery:
  • Help children explore the what? how? and why? of their experiences
  • Encourage and invite them to contribute by trying new things they can do
  • Celebrate when you see success
  • Always show respect when helping to learn lessons
Adaptability and flexibility
Help children to understand that things don’t always go as planned. Being flexible and able to change is an important characteristic of resilience.

When a child is going through a life transition or big change, this can be a great learning opportunity to show how change can be dealt with and perceived in a positive way.

Help children to:
  • Gain a perception of personal control over the environment.
  • Try something new and understand there are many ways to solve a problem.
  • Recognize that different environment require different behavior.
Everyone wants their kids to be happy and successful in life. A major part of this is instilling the wisdom that life will have ups and downs, and that despite this, everyone is valuable and capable of accomplishing their goals. It may just take a little hard work and persistence.

Shaken-Baby Cases Rising During the Recession


The stressful effects of a faltering economy, skyrocketing unemployment and precarious personal finances can be dire. People take up smoking or use alcohol to cope, they become depressed or suicidal, and they develop stress-related illnesses like heart disease.

Now researchers report that the harm may be spreading to children too, when parents' stress leads them to injure their children, inadvertently.

Presenting May 1 at the Paediatric Academic Societies annual meeting in Vancouver, a team of researchers led by child-abuse expert Dr. Rachel Berger at Children's Hospital of Pittsburgh reported a significant increase in cases of shaken-baby syndrome, in which youngsters are shaken violently by an adult, since the start of the current recession.

Researchers analysed data on 512 cases of head trauma in the children's centers of four hospitals (in Pittsburgh, Pa.; Cincinnati, Ohio; Columbus, Ohio; and Seattle) and found that the number of cases had increased to 9.3 per month as of Dec. 1, 2007, compared with 6 per month prior to that date — a rate that had held steady since 2004.

Self Esteem and Stress Management

Individuals with learning disabilities often struggle with self esteem because of poor academic performance or difficulties with social relationships.

Most parents want to help their children develop self esteem. For the child without special needs it’s a challenge—but for the youngster with extra issues, it can seem like an overwhelming task.

There are some essential facts to keep in mind. Self esteem is not static. It can fluctuate depending on one’s state of mind and circumstances. Parents can only do so much to help their child. After a certain age, a parent’s input, while still crucial, is only part of the confidence equation.

As children age, peer input as well as their ability to accomplish become an important part of how they develop self confidence. Still, it’s our job as parents to try to bolster our kids when they feel low.

Building Self-esteem and confidence

Here are 7 easy tips that will help you build self esteem.

  • Be generous with affecion; lots of hugs and kisses.
  • Take plenty baby pictures. Everyone wants to see how they looked as a baby. Too often parents of children who look different avoid talking pictures of their kids as babies and as they grow.
  • Don’t allow your child’s condition to define him e.g. he’s not an autistic child; he’s a child who suffers from autism.
  • Be a compassionate listener and do not be judgemental. Try to understand who your child is and where they are coming from, even if you initially disagree with his or her perception of a situation.
  • Use honest, open communication at all times. Kids know when you’re lying and hiding things from them.
  • Don’t compare your child unfavourably with other children. Be happy with and focus on, his accomplishments.
  • Become aware of your own attitudes of people’s appearances and their limitations. If need be, tone down any negative comments. Parents who make positive and negative comments about other people send the message that physical perfection is important and has a high priority.

Ultimately, it’s important to parents to understand their own feelings about appearance, disability and imperfection, so they can fully accept their child for the wonderful gift he really is.
